Contractor week one, Arnfield site. Sign in daily at the south gatehouse before 08:00. Hard hats and hi-vis are mandatory past the yellow line; bring your own or collect loaners from the store. No photography inside the plant. Your site induction runs Monday morning and must be completed before tool access. Breaks are taken in the Portakabin by Gate 2, not on the floor. Until your permanent badge is printed, enter the gatehouse turnstile using the code below.

badge for badup-kahif: bdg-LHI-9

### Step 4: Compression settings

Enabling permessage-deflate on Relaygate cuts bandwidth ~60% but raises CPU and memory per socket. For support escalations: disable compression first when clients report stalls on slow links. Restart the edge pods after toggling. Before redeploying, sign the config bundle with the deploy key shown directly below.

signing key of bagap-yawep = bky13_TbfT6ZMUoGJo2

BRIEFING — LEADERSHIP REVIEW

To the finance team: the Calyx Works division requests an additional allocation for the Penhollow tooling upgrade. The case rests on a 14-month payback, reduced scrap rates, and capacity for the Verrow product line launch. Engineering estimates are third-party validated; contingency is set at ten percent. Approval is recommended subject to staged release tied to milestones. The confidential note below explains how this fits our broader plans.

confidential, yajof-fadug: Project Julvan slips by one quarter because of the audit delay.

Capacity note for the Bramblewick export retry queue. Failed exports are requeued with exponential backoff, and the queue depth is our main capacity signal: sustained depth above the high-water mark means downstream Pellis storage is saturated, not that we need more workers. As the new contractor, please don't raise worker counts without checking storage latency first — it usually makes things worse. Retry timing, backoff caps, and the high-water threshold are all driven by the constants shown below.

limits module of yagef-bajog:
TIERS = {
    "druael": 370,
    "tamix": 286,
    "pelius": 541,
    "pelael": 78,
    "pelox": 47,
    "ralath": 533,
    "drumir": 801,
}